CISA Lists Two Active Exploited Vulnerabilities

The US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Security Agency (CISA) has identified two vulnerabilities actively exploited by attackers: CVE-2022-0492 affecting Linux Kernel authentication and CVE-2025-48595 impacting Android Framework. These have been added to CISA's Known Exploited Vulnerabilities catalog, which tracks threats to critical infrastructure. While mandatory remediation applies to US federal agencies under Binding Operational Directive 22-01, CISA recommends all organizations prioritize patching these vulnerabilities to reduce cyberattack exposure. The catalog serves as a living resource for vulnerability management practices globally. Source: CISA.
